Get Access To All JobsTips for Finding H-1B Visa Sponsorship as an Operations Project Manager
Align your degree to SOC codes
USCIS evaluates specialty occupation by matching your degree field to the role's SOC code. Pull the O*NET profile for Operations Project Manager and confirm your transcript reflects a directly related discipline before applying.
Target E-Verify enrolled employers first
If you're on OPT cap-gap, your employer must be E-Verify enrolled for your work authorization to bridge to October 1. Filter your job search to E-Verify participants so you don't lose authorization between selection and the start date.
Verify prevailing wage before negotiating an offer
Your employer's LCA must certify a wage at or above the DOL prevailing wage for your location and role level. Run the OFLC Wage Search before your offer call so you can flag underpaying offers that would block LCA certification.
Search LCA filing history on Migrate Mate
Use Migrate Mate to filter Operations Project Manager roles by employers with verified H-1B LCA filing history. This surfaces companies that have already navigated the specialty occupation determination for this job title, reducing your petition risk.
Flag project management certifications in your petition
A PMP or CAPM certification strengthens the specialty occupation argument when your role involves cross-functional coordination without a narrowly defined degree requirement. Include certification documentation in your I-129 supporting evidence package.
Request premium processing during job transitions
Operations roles often have firm start dates tied to project cycles. Premium processing delivers an I-129 decision within 15 business days through USCIS, giving both you and your employer a definite onboarding timeline instead of a months-long wait.
H-1B Visa Operations Project Manager: Frequently Asked Questions
Does an Operations Project Manager role qualify as a specialty occupation for H-1B purposes?
Yes, if the position requires at least a bachelor's degree in a directly related field such as business administration, industrial engineering, supply chain management, or operations management. Generic management roles that accept any degree can face RFEs, so the job description must tie the degree requirement to specific duties. Employers typically document this through the LCA and the I-129 support letter.
Which industries sponsor H-1B visas most often for Operations Project Manager positions?
Manufacturing, logistics and distribution, technology, healthcare systems, and aerospace file the highest volumes of H-1B LCAs for operations and project management titles. These industries run complex, multi-site operations where the specialty occupation argument is easier to establish. You can confirm which specific employers have active filing history for this title through Migrate Mate before targeting your applications.
Can my employer file an H-1B for an Operations Project Manager role if I currently hold OPT?
Yes. Your employer must register you in the H-1B lottery during the March registration window. If selected, they file the full I-129 petition. If you're on STEM OPT, you have up to 24 additional months of work authorization, which gives you two more lottery cycles. The employer must be E-Verify enrolled to maintain your authorization through any cap-gap period.
What documentation does my employer need to prove specialty occupation for this role?
The employer's support letter must explain why a bachelor's degree in a specific field is the minimum requirement for the position, not just a preference. Job postings, internal job descriptions, organization charts showing comparable positions, and industry wage surveys all strengthen the petition. USCIS also looks at whether similar roles at the company have historically required the same degree, so prior LCA history for the title matters.
How does the H-1B prevailing wage requirement affect Operations Project Manager job offers?
The employer must pay at least the DOL prevailing wage for your job title, location, and experience level, as certified in the LCA. Operations Project Manager roles span wage levels one through four depending on supervision and complexity. Before accepting an offer, verify the applicable wage level using the OFLC Wage Search so you can confirm the offer meets the legal minimum and won't delay LCA certification.
